- Original: ἄγνωστος - Transliteration: Agnostos - Phonetic: ag'-noce-tos' - Definition: 1. unknown, forgotten Epimenides, a certain Cretan, came to Athens to stop a plague. Heoffered a sheep on alters the born no name of no God but to theunknown God. At least one of the alters survived to Paul's day. - Origin: from G1 (as negative particle) and G1110 - TDNT entry: 02:59,2 - Part(s) of speech: Adjective - Strong's: From G1 (as negative particle) and G1110 ; unknown: - unknown.
